It does require team offence though, something that's not usually found in pick-up basketball. Can't beat a zone on your own.

6

u/RRJC10 Dec 15 '25

Can't beat a zone on your own

Can't beat a good zone. I highly doubt the zone OP is referring is too advanced. I'd be shocked if anything more than a drive and kick was needed to beat a pick-up zone. Unless you have zero shooting ability and they're just packing the paint.
